Specifications, Pricing and Availability

 

mydigitalssd_bp3_512gb_sata_iii_solid_state_drive_phison_s8_exclusive_preview

 

MyDigitalSSD will run with all the standard capacity sizes from 64GB to a massive 512GB. We suspect a 1TB model is in the works as well judging from the layout of the 512GB model we are looking at today.

 


MyDigitalSSD claims read performance at 490MB/s with 16K IOPS. Write performance is a claimed 310MB/s at 46K IOPS. These numbers are produced on a SATA III interface and this is the first time Phison has entered the SATA III market.

 

When comparing the BP3 to power user drives that use SandForce controllers, there is no question that the SandForce drives outperform the BP3 on paper. The Phison S8 is a budget offering though and is designed to be a low-cost solution. As a budget minded product, it has to have the price to back that claim up and MyDigitalSSD has come through in that area.

 

The BP3 512GB has a normal cost of $499.99, but with a TweakTown coupon code (TT512BP3SAVE25) MyDigitalSSD is taking off another $25. Additionally, the 256GB BP3 model has a coupon code as well (TT512BP3SAVE10) that is good for $10 off.

 

Being a budget release there aren't any accessories included with the package. We would of liked to of seen a desktop adapter bracket tossed in the package. You do get a three year warranty though which is longer than what many companies provide with their budget SSDs.
